Parent's Club Supports Kansas Beta
T
o start the school year, our Parent's Club and the men of Sigma Phi Epsilon welcomed
incoming freshmen and their parents during move-in day. The day included a wonderful
lunch at the Chapter House. Mom Veith was there to welcome them all!
The men of SigEp enjoyed Dad's Weekend on October 7. The fun-filled day started with a
round of golf at Colbert Hills, then lunch and a watch party for the KSU vs. Texas game.
The following weekend, October 14, was Family Weekend, which was celebrated at the
Chapter House with a tailgate barbecue before the game.
In the spring, the men will welcome their mothers to the house for Mom's Weekend on April
14. Mom's Weekend will be celebrated with lunch, a silent auction, and other activities that
are still in the works!
We will continue to provide monthly pizza for dinner, starting one Sunday each month
beginning in September. The Parent's Club will be adding some upgrades to the house this
year from the contributions raised at Dad's and Mom's Weekend events.
Looking forward a great year!

Chapter Eternal
R. Bernell "Bernie" Kerbs '51 entered
Chapter Eternal on March 25, at the age of
87, as a resident of Tacoma, Wash. He and
his wife, Diantha Horton, fellow KSU graduate,
spent 60 years together. With his mechanical
engineering degree, Bernie proudly worked
for Boeing on various projects for 40 years.
Bernie and his wife traveled extensively after
his retirement, including China, Sweden,
Europe, England, Turkey, and all over the
United States. Bernie was a kind, gracious,
and caring man who saw the good in all things.
He will be greatly missed.
Montague "Monty" Weckel '65 entered
Chapter Eternal on January 12, as a resident
of Charlotte, N.C. He graduated from Kansas
State University with a degree in architecture.
He served in the Army Reserve, receiving a
medal for sharp shooting. He was president
of Weckel Equipment Co. During his career
he was presented with numerous awards,
including one for Lifetime Sales achievement.
Monty was a member of Sardis Presbyterian
Church. A highlight of his life was a booklet
written for his grandchildren giving them
practical life advice. He is survived by his wife
of 50 years, Caroline.
